The creator of the creator is not equal

First of all, it is important to note the distinction between Creators based on the format or convention they choose. A different contribution of the work requires recording a vlog, and a completely different preparation of a film with a plot, based on a script that takes into account several different locations and characters.

Those who make videos often and publish regularly, also focusing on advanced editing, need more mental stamina and the ability to work under time pressure. There are also Creators whose videos appear once or several times a month, but they are complex enough that they require the involvement of the entire backroom of people. In this case, the youtuber must have a lot of skills, for example organizational

- notes Maciej Ejsmont, known on YouTube as Sheo.

It often happens that the Creator, especially at the beginning of his path, plays the role of both screenwriter, cameraman and editor. Acquiring such a competency package takes time and work, but practice makes a master. The principle is simple — the more time you spend on video creation, the more practice you get and over time you create better and better content in terms of quality and substance.

Find your place on YouTube

Do you think YouTube has it all? Nothing more wrong. Of course, it is much more difficult to be original today than it was a few years ago. Competition is high, and creating a tracing paper from existing channels is a poor way to attract viewers.

The basis is imagination and creativity. Before launching a new channel, it is worth doing research and shooting yourself with something new, not duplicating schemes. Then our chance of success increases.

— advise the creators of the Jelenie Jaja channel.

A good idea is half the battle, but even the most creative youtuber has to face a lack of venom someday. So where do we get inspiration for action? Curiosity about the world, exploring topics in your area of interest and attentive observation of current events - these are ways to constantly fuel enthusiasm for further work and avoid burnout.

Youtuber should follow the latest trends, not only in video, but also in fashion or music, in order to then be able, in the case of entertainment channels like ours, to parody them and portray them in a crooked mirror.

— says Nadia, ½ of Beksa's channel.

Knowledge of YouTube is important

If you decide to do activities on YouTube, you should know your “place of work” well. It is important to understand the laws that govern this platform. This is important if we are talking about the customs regarding the cooperation of the Creators, their contacts with the audience, as well as in the context of the technical aspects of the activity.

Optimizing your channel properly helps increase its growth in both new subscribers and views. Using the tools provided by the service, we can influence the positioning of the channel and materials in the search engine, or increase the engagement of viewers

Every detail counts, including title, description, keywords, or end screens. Knowledge of YouTube mechanisms will even allow you to increase the reach of materials to potential subscribers several times.

There is no shortcut

Building a loyal community takes time. In order to convince the audience, the Creator must offer them some value — he can educate them in some field, or provide entertainment. If what he posts is appealing to viewers, they will surely let him know and ask for more. However, this does not mean that after the second video, which did not go viral, you should hide the camera in a drawer.

Developers should not be afraid to take risks and experiment with formats. They also have to be persistent, often in many hours of work

— adds Sheo.

It is therefore worth trying, trying and trying again, but the goal is to create good content, and not just to conquer the subscription counter. The important ones are: authenticity, creativity, passion, but also a good relationship with the camera.

It is imperative to leave shame and uncertainty outside the frame. People who feel like a fish in water in front of the camera and are not bothered by its presence are more likely to be viewed

— adds Nadia Długosz.
